Another way that you can use aluminum foil to bake cookies is by wrapping the foil around the oven rack, skipping … WebPlace up to 4 cookies in the pan about 1 inch apart and cover with a lid. Allow the cookies to cook in a pan over low heat for 15-17 minutes. The cookies are done when they are crisp on the bottom and just set on top. If they seem slightly underdone, don’t be alarmed as they set as they cool.
WebOne thing you should absolutely avoid is have aluminum in contact with another metal when both are in contact with a liquid, especially an acidic liquid, or even your food surface. This creates a basic battery and will cause metal ions to migrate at a much higher rate. I left a roast chicken in my baking pan and covered it in foil, but on the ...
